Why are the negative numbers included?

When you multiply two negative numbers together, you get a positive number. That means both the positive and negative numbers are factors of 2,805,275.

Example:
1 x 2,805,275 = 2,805,275
and
-1 x -2,805,275 = 2,805,275
Notice both answers equal 2,805,275
